Job Summary:

Supporting Disney Advertising Sales, the Data Science Engineering team are subject matter experts in each of the following areas:

•          Integrating a broad suite of complex datasets, from digital event logs to sporting event metadata, into carefully curated and reusable data models

•          Creating and optimizing audience classification models that enable us to predict and target strategic audience attributes, including brand affinity, purchase behavior, and psychographics

•          Publishing audience attributes across an array of ad-serving endpoints

•          Working cross-functionally to ensure our data product is aligned with the goals of each strategic sales vertical and the business as a whole

We’re looking for an intellectually curious, business-savvy, analytical powerhouse to join Disney Ad Sales as a data science engineer on the Data Measurement Science team. In this role, you will be responsible for driving improvements across DET’s portfolio of offerings by using data. Working collaboratively with cross-functional teams, you will develop, drive, and oversee new strategies to ensure the growth of the business and the overall bottom line.

Responsibilities and Duties of the Role:

  • Develop data processing pipelines, stitching together streaming, advertising, and other feeds at the terabyte scale
  • Collaborate on the transformation of existing ML code into portable and automated services
  • Expand your skills in data governance and DevOps best practices by supporting ongoing team efforts to integrate data catalogues, data lineage, and CI/CD solutions into day-to-day operations.

Required Education, Experience/Skills/Training:

Minimum

  • Minimum of 3 years of related work experience.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, Software, Electrical or Electronics Engineering, or comparable field of study, and/or equivalent work experience​
  • Strong SQL skills, preference to processing large datasets in BigQuery and Snowflake .
  • Good Python skills, including a demonstrated ability to read and understand code.
  • Experience collaborating to team projects in Git and GitHub.
  • Detail-oriented with a passion for organization and elegance.

Preferred:

  • Experience in data process orchestration tools (e.g. Airflow).
  • Experience in infrastructure-as-code (e.g. Terraform).
  • Containerized development patterns (e.g. Docker, Kubernetes).
  • Other cloud computing experience (e.g. GCP, AWS).

The Walt Disney Company, together with its subsidiaries and affiliates, is a leading diversified international family entertainment and media enterprise that includes three core business segments: Disney Entertainment, ESPN, and Disney Experiences. From humble beginnings as a cartoon studio in the 1920s to its preeminent name in the entertainment industry today, Disney proudly continues its legacy of creating world-class stories and experiences for every member of the family. Disney’s stories, characters and experiences reach consumers and guests from every corner of the globe. With operations in more than 40 countries, our employees and cast members work together to create entertainment experiences that are both universally and locally cherished.
